Artist Statement
Edition of 3 + AP
Huge bubbles usually appear in entertaining magic shows. They carry a lot of metaphors. Such dreamlike visual experience often vanishes in an instant, such as the modern Crystal Palace which is a huge bubble, the most ideal symbol of capitalist globalization, modernity also points to the transition, fleeting and accidental. And all that is strong will disappear. At the same time, the formation of these bubbles is caused by the wind blowing, or the formation of the bubbles is the shape of the wind, so it is a description of the wind itself. In the non-daily observation of negative film, things appear out of the usual way for us, which makes us pay more attention to the outline and form itself in the image.

Chen Xiaoyi was born in Sichuan, China in 1992. She received an MA Photography from London College of Communication in 2014, currently lives and works in Chengdu.
